Voices For Children Of Broward County To Host Back-To-School Extravaganza

South Florida Sun Times

Jul 9, 2026

Back To School, Back To Saving The Day! Voices For Children Of Broward County (Voices) Is Hosting A Back-To-School Extravaganza At Old Navy In Oakwood Plaza In Hollywood On Sunday, August 2nd, 2026 From 9:00 a.m. To 11 a.m. The Back-to-School Extravaganza Is A Part Of Voices’ Year-Long 15th Anniversary Celebration And Expands Its Mission To Ensure That Every Child And Young Adult In Broward County Who Has Experienced Abuse, Neglect, Or Abandonment Has Access To Essential Resources And Programs That Promote Long-Term Stability And Well-Being.

Over 100 children in foster care will have the opportunity to shop for their back-to-school essentials alongside real-life superheroes, including Voices volunteers, Hollywood Police Department, City of Hollywood Fire Rescue & Beach Safety, Broward County Sheriff’s Office, Spiderman, Disney Encanto’s Mirabel and KPop Star Rumi.


Attendees will enjoy a fun-filled morning, including breakfast, face painting, activities, and a surprise appearance by Florida Panthers Stanley C. Panther. Each child will receive brand-new clothes, a backpack full of first-day essentials and the reminder that their community sees them as the heroes they truly are.


“The start of a new school year should feel exciting, not overwhelming, but for many children, showing up without the right supplies, clothing, or resources can make that first day feel out of reach,” said Voices President and CEO Erica Herman. “A backpack stocked with school supplies represents so much more than pencils and notebooks. It sends a powerful message to a child that they matter, that they are seen, and that someone is in their corner rooting for their success.”

The Back-to-School Extravaganza is a part of Voices’ longstanding signature program, Dream Big Days, and is designed for children in foster care. Voices’ Dream Big Days is a transformative program designed to provide enriching experiences and core memory-making opportunities for children in foster care. Through a series of specially curated events and activities, Dream Big Days aims to broaden horizons, ignite curiosity, and foster personal growth among participants. These immersive experiences offer children the chance to explore new interests, discover hidden talents, and create lasting memories that transcend the challenges of their circumstances.

About Voices for Children of Broward County (Voices):

Each year, Voices for Children of Broward County (Voices) works to make the foster care experience better for over 2,500 children in the South Florida community, so they can rise with strength, dignity, and hope. Voices is dedicated to ensuring that every child and young adult who is a victim of abuse, neglect, and abandonment in Broward County has access to the resources and programs needed to support their health, educational, and social well-being. Through its core programs, Voices provides advocacy, case management, age-appropriate referrals, and wraparound services that work to create an abuse-free future for every child. In collaboration with the 17th Judicial Circuit Dependency Court Division and community partners, Voices serves children with open dependency court cases, committed to meeting their essential needs and ensuring they have a voice throughout the court process.
